Option 1: Linen Button Up Shirt
A linen button up is a viable option to cover your midsection during summer. And before you say it’s too hot where you live to wear long sleeves, I live near Key West for most of the year. We wear linen long sleeves all year round to protect our skin from the sun. Linen is a breathable fabric that allows air to flow through it and cool the skin. Here, I paired this baby blue linen button up with white linen joggers and white sport sandals for an effortless chic summer look. Shop this outfit here.

Option 2: Wrap Blouse or Faux Wrap Blouse
A wrap blouse (or a faux wrap blouse like this one) that ties below the bustling but above the waist is a good option to conceal the midsection. In this outfit, the faux wrap blouse is gathered below the bustling with a flutter hem to cover my midsection. Option 3: Tie Waist Blouse
I love a tie blouse because you can control how much coverage for your midsection based on how tight you tie it. In this outfit, I have paired the tie blouse with white linen crop pants and a straw tote bag for a coastal grandmother or coastal casual summer outfit. Shop this outfit here.
